A study of the progression of protestantism in history will reveal that the first schizm induced by Martin Luther at Worms produced the first breakaway church from Catholicism and it was soon labled the Lutheran Church. Later... God caused another son to rise with another message of reform against the concreted orthodoxy of the Lutheran Organization. Still later ... another reformer arose and reacted to the new 'denomination'. All protestant denominations were initially reactionary non-conformist radicals despised by the conservative middle-of-the-roaders of their day. So what does this tell the sincere Christian interested in going all0the-way with God? Follow Jesus. He always led from the EDGE of the crowd. He NEVER sought consensus. He introduced controversy from the center of scripture. God is dynamic and the christian experience is also dynamic, or it is nothing more than a hollow shell and a sham. I want religion that is REAL, not just another secret handshake and a bucket of fried chicken. How about YOU>?

Hello my brothers and sisters in the Lord,

Most people don't realize the radical experiment we are doing here! I want you to imagine yourself -- hundreds of years ago -- when all the different denominations were starting! While everyone was insisting their beliefs were the "only" correct way to worship God -- they were creating more and more splits and divisions!

What we are trying to do at Worthy Boards is unheard of when you think about it! We are trying to unify the body -- while at the same time protect those fundamental truths that we can all agree with -- the need for salvation through Jesus -- the source for truth for living the Christian life found within the Bible. Read our Statement of faith! This experiment hasn't happened before when you really consider it!

Of course there's the ecumenical movement -- unity for the sake of doctrinal compromises! I'm sorry, but the fundamental doctrines of the faith can't be compromised.

So often though when you have so many different denominations, you have many different avenues of thought that have never been explored by other denominations. Just because a teaching is "different" than one you are used to hearing, doesn't necessarily mean it's wrong -- it may be just different!

But differences of opinion is actually a good thing whether you realize it or not! For God didn't create us to be the SAME body part -- but created us all different so that we could join together to form the body of Christ to compliment each other!

Oftentimes I learn by realizing other avenues of thinking presented by various believers. By allowing various avenues of thoughts we expand our horizons and allow the Spirit of God to realign our thoughts with the mind of Christ and continue our growth in the maturity of the Lord.

So before you run out and cry "heretic" or "false teacher", be sure to carefully listen, and observe what someone is saying. I honestly believe that things "heard through the grapevine" have a way of being twisted -- but if you go to the source then you can carefully examine the fruit -- test the fruit -- and then make a judgment -- oftentimes you may find that the red grape you were expecting to find was just a white grape -- it was just a different color, but when you examined the fruit -- you find out it's still good fruit!

We need to recognize that every word spoken, we will be judged for. And everyone that is hindered from hearing the gospel because someone feels the need to scream - heretic, false prophet, or demeaning someone in some fashion -- let's just say I wouldn't want to be that person sitting before the Lord at the Bema Seat!

This is a problem that I do have and I want to voice my concerns now and I hope you carefully heed these words. When someone comes into the boards, who is not necessarily a Christian -- the first thing you should do is NOT castigate them.

The first thing you should do before you even post -- what would Jesus do? Did Jesus say -- get away from me you prostitute? or get away from me you heathen? or say give me the first stone because I am without sin?

Jesus didn't go closing doors, He went forth OPENING the DOOR so ALL could enter in!

John 17:20-21

A study of the progression of protestantism in history will reveal that the first schizm induced by Martin Luther at Worms produced the first breakaway church from Catholicism and it was soon labled the Lutheran Church.

I just wanted to clarify that Martin Luther did not intend these divisions...what he wanted to see was reform within the current church*, not the separation of a whole bunch of different churches. Poor guy gets an awfully bad rep for trying to do the right thing, IMO.

From this page on Lutheran History.

It should be pointed out that Luther did not intend to break with the Roman Catholic Church. His intention was only to cleanse it of its teachings and practices that lacked basis in the Bible.

* As always, when I refer to the body of Christ I use the word "Church" with an uppercase "C," and when referring to the church as an organization I use the lowercase "c."
